Searched refs:sysfs_lock (Results 1 – 14 of 14) sorted by relevance
24 static DEFINE_MUTEX(sysfs_lock);31 mutex_lock(&sysfs_lock); in fsl_free_resource()39 mutex_unlock(&sysfs_lock); in fsl_free_resource()57 mutex_lock(&sysfs_lock); in fsl_timer_wakeup_show()62 mutex_unlock(&sysfs_lock); in fsl_timer_wakeup_show()78 mutex_lock(&sysfs_lock); in fsl_timer_wakeup_store()87 mutex_unlock(&sysfs_lock); in fsl_timer_wakeup_store()94 mutex_unlock(&sysfs_lock); in fsl_timer_wakeup_store()102 mutex_unlock(&sysfs_lock); in fsl_timer_wakeup_store()109 mutex_unlock(&sysfs_lock); in fsl_timer_wakeup_store()[all …]
78 mutex_lock(&q->sysfs_lock); in blk_mq_sysfs_show()81 mutex_unlock(&q->sysfs_lock); in blk_mq_sysfs_show()101 mutex_lock(&q->sysfs_lock); in blk_mq_sysfs_store()104 mutex_unlock(&q->sysfs_lock); in blk_mq_sysfs_store()124 mutex_lock(&q->sysfs_lock); in blk_mq_hw_sysfs_show()127 mutex_unlock(&q->sysfs_lock); in blk_mq_hw_sysfs_show()148 mutex_lock(&q->sysfs_lock); in blk_mq_hw_sysfs_store()151 mutex_unlock(&q->sysfs_lock); in blk_mq_hw_sysfs_store()
803 mutex_lock(&q->sysfs_lock); in queue_attr_show()805 mutex_unlock(&q->sysfs_lock); in queue_attr_show()809 mutex_unlock(&q->sysfs_lock); in queue_attr_show()825 mutex_lock(&q->sysfs_lock); in queue_attr_store()827 mutex_unlock(&q->sysfs_lock); in queue_attr_store()831 mutex_unlock(&q->sysfs_lock); in queue_attr_store()991 mutex_lock(&q->sysfs_lock); in blk_register_queue()995 mutex_unlock(&q->sysfs_lock); in blk_register_queue()1013 mutex_unlock(&q->sysfs_lock); in blk_register_queue()1045 mutex_lock(&q->sysfs_lock); in blk_unregister_queue()[all …]
175 mutex_init(&eq->sysfs_lock); in elevator_alloc()193 mutex_lock(&e->sysfs_lock); in __elevator_exit()196 mutex_unlock(&e->sysfs_lock); in __elevator_exit()449 mutex_lock(&e->sysfs_lock); in elv_attr_show()451 mutex_unlock(&e->sysfs_lock); in elv_attr_show()467 mutex_lock(&e->sysfs_lock); in elv_attr_store()469 mutex_unlock(&e->sysfs_lock); in elv_attr_store()586 lockdep_assert_held(&q->sysfs_lock); in elevator_switch_mq()714 lockdep_assert_held(&q->sysfs_lock); in elevator_switch()
466 res = mutex_lock_interruptible(&q->sysfs_lock); in hctx_tags_show()471 mutex_unlock(&q->sysfs_lock); in hctx_tags_show()483 res = mutex_lock_interruptible(&q->sysfs_lock); in hctx_tags_bitmap_show()488 mutex_unlock(&q->sysfs_lock); in hctx_tags_bitmap_show()500 res = mutex_lock_interruptible(&q->sysfs_lock); in hctx_sched_tags_show()505 mutex_unlock(&q->sysfs_lock); in hctx_sched_tags_show()517 res = mutex_lock_interruptible(&q->sysfs_lock); in hctx_sched_tags_bitmap_show()522 mutex_unlock(&q->sysfs_lock); in hctx_sched_tags_bitmap_show()
340 mutex_lock(&q->sysfs_lock); in blk_cleanup_queue()346 mutex_unlock(&q->sysfs_lock); in blk_cleanup_queue()377 mutex_lock(&q->sysfs_lock); in blk_cleanup_queue()380 mutex_unlock(&q->sysfs_lock); in blk_cleanup_queue()523 mutex_init(&q->sysfs_lock); in blk_alloc_queue_node()
204 lockdep_assert_held(&q->sysfs_lock); in elevator_exit()
2793 mutex_lock(&q->sysfs_lock); in blk_mq_realloc_hw_ctxs()2844 mutex_unlock(&q->sysfs_lock); in blk_mq_realloc_hw_ctxs()3219 mutex_lock(&q->sysfs_lock); in blk_mq_elv_switch_none()3229 mutex_unlock(&q->sysfs_lock); in blk_mq_elv_switch_none()3252 mutex_lock(&q->sysfs_lock); in blk_mq_elv_switch_back()3254 mutex_unlock(&q->sysfs_lock); in blk_mq_elv_switch_back()
35 static DEFINE_MUTEX(sysfs_lock);591 mutex_lock(&sysfs_lock); in gpiod_export()639 mutex_unlock(&sysfs_lock); in gpiod_export()645 mutex_unlock(&sysfs_lock); in gpiod_export()707 mutex_lock(&sysfs_lock); in gpiod_unexport()728 mutex_unlock(&sysfs_lock); in gpiod_unexport()736 mutex_unlock(&sysfs_lock); in gpiod_unexport()772 mutex_lock(&sysfs_lock); in gpiochip_sysfs_register()774 mutex_unlock(&sysfs_lock); in gpiochip_sysfs_register()791 mutex_lock(&sysfs_lock); in gpiochip_sysfs_unregister()[all …]
22 static DEFINE_MUTEX(sysfs_lock);193 mutex_lock(&sysfs_lock); in dual_select_store()200 mutex_unlock(&sysfs_lock); in dual_select_store()211 mutex_lock(&sysfs_lock); in dual_select_show()213 mutex_unlock(&sysfs_lock); in dual_select_show()
111 struct mutex sysfs_lock; member832 mutex_lock(&battery->sysfs_lock); in sysfs_remove_battery()834 mutex_unlock(&battery->sysfs_lock); in sysfs_remove_battery()841 mutex_unlock(&battery->sysfs_lock); in sysfs_remove_battery()1391 mutex_init(&battery->sysfs_lock); in acpi_battery_add()1421 mutex_destroy(&battery->sysfs_lock); in acpi_battery_add()1440 mutex_destroy(&battery->sysfs_lock); in acpi_battery_remove()
106 struct mutex sysfs_lock; member
546 struct mutex sysfs_lock; member
29 #1: (&eq->sysfs_lock){+.+.}, at: [<ffffffff812a5032>]